Zbrush Not Enough Memory Issue

My PC spec:
Core i7, 860, 2.8Ghz
8 Gb rams
ATI FireGL v.5600 (512 rams)

As the title suggested, Zbrush screams for a memory error every time I try to create a 4k Displacement map. I have a low poly mesh, in which, I subdivide it to level 8 as I sculpt, and it gets to 18 Mill polys. When I bring back the model to level 1 and try to create a 4K displacement map, Zbrush pops up a warning message that my machine hasn’t enough memory.

I went down to level 7 and deleted level 8 and tried again to create a 4k displacement map and it works.

I always thought that 8 Gb rams would be enough, so my question is… am I doing something very wrong here?

If I upgrade to 16 Gb rams, will Zbrush still tells me I don’t have enough memory to create a level 8, 4k, displacement map?

Any suggestions / feedbacks is appreciated.

Thank you.

Upgrading to 16 GB RAM will not solve your problem as ZBrush is a 32 bit app and will only use 4GB RAM max, even on a 64 bit OS. What are your -Preferences > Mem- settings? You shouldn’t use any more than the default 4 Doc and Tool Undo. If that is set higher it will quickly eat up all your available RAM. Try making your displacement map without any Undo history stored and see if that works. i.e. Init ZBrush > redraw ztool > create displacement map.
